A Look into Anonymous Duo, Doublethink’s Single, “Doom Scrolling”

An unidentified and secretive duo, fronted by an American Fulbright researcher and a peacebuilding professional, makes up the project entitled Doublethink. While anonymous, the two met on Soundcloud after finding a likeness and similarity in their politically motivated interests in their musical craft. They have been creating their work since then from the bedroom of an apartment in Amman, Jordan.

Sending the world as we know spinning into a new perspective of pop music, in their single, “Doom Scrolling,” especially, the audience is enthralled into a punk and new wave experience sonically as the lyrics depict the building paranoias behind the media as it is today, and what its power can very well hold in the future. The vocals are deadpan, instilling a sense of anxiety as a thrashing guitar only builds it further. And as the chorus offers concrete visuals of a character scrolling through their phone, the content they pan through continues to become more upsetting until as a result, they become de-sensitized to the horrors occurring around them. At the song’s climax, the vocalist sings, “Facebook’s down tonight,” and as a result, there’s a contrasting feeling of catharsis released and a sense of dread as the project leaves the listener up to the question: are they really better off with or without technology in the way?
